Mumbai City FC strengthened their midfield with the loan signing of 26-year-old midfielder Hitesh Sharma from Odisha FC. This deal means Sharma will wear Islander’s blue jersey until the end of the 2024-25 season.

Gokulam Kerala FC, the two-time I-league champion, has announced the signing of Sergio Llamas, a highly talented 31-year-old Spanish midfielder who also excels as an attacking midfielder. Sergio joins the Malabarians from Guabira, a club in Bolivia’s first division.

After many hot rumours, Mohun Bagan Super Giants have announced the arrival of Spanish defender Alberto Rodriguez from Indonesian club Persib Bandung. Rodriguez becomes Bagan’s 4th signing of the summer, joining Jamie Maclaren, Apuia Ralte, and Tom Aldred.

Dempo Sports Club, a legendary name in Indian football, has returned to the I-League after a nine-year hiatus.

Vukomanovic leaves Kerala Blasters as the club’s most successful coach in terms of several metrics. He holds the record for most games managed and most wins.

Kerala United FC, formerly known as Calicut Quartz FC, has been a symbol of the Malabar region’s footballing heritage. Founded in 1976, the club has a rich history and a strong connection to the local community.

Unlike other clubs of Bhopal or Madhya Pradesh, Lake City FC have a long-term plan. This club is a passion project of the owners of Jagran Lake City University, the same team that owns the Delhi Public School of Bhopal.
